A particle is executing SHM. Then the graph of velocity as a function of displacement is

A

straight line

B

circle

C

ellipse

D

hyperbola

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C

`v=omegasqrt(A^2-x^2)`
`v^2/omega^2+x^2=A^2implies(v^2)/(omega^2A^2)+x^2/A^2=1`
v v/s x is ellipse
